Best time to experience Kenya safari packages
Dry Season from June to October
Kenya safari packages are most rewarding in the dry season, as animals gather around water sources, making sightings predictable and abundant. From July to September, the Great Migration brings millions of wildebeest and zebras into the Masai Mara, offering dramatic wildlife action. Weather is generally warm, skies are clear, and road conditions are favorable, which enhances both photography and comfort. Kenya safari packages during this period are popular, so travelers should expect higher demand and plan early to secure accommodations. This season is ideal for those who prioritize wildlife density and want to combine safari with a beach extension at Diani, where the coast enjoys sunny weather.
Short Dry Season from January to February
Kenya safari packages in January and February are also highly recommended, especially for travelers who prefer fewer crowds compared to the migration months. Wildlife viewing remains excellent, with many species giving birth, which increases predator activity. The weather is hot and dry, making conditions comfortable for game drives and photography. Kenya safari packages at this time often come with slightly lower rates than peak migration season, offering good value for travelers. Birdwatching is also rewarding, as migratory species are present. Combining safari with Diani Beach during these months ensures warm coastal weather, perfect for relaxation after days in the parks
How to get there for Kenya safari packages
Most Kenya safari packages begin in Nairobi, which is the main international gateway. Travelers usually arrive at Jomo Kenyatta International Airport, where connections to domestic flights, road transfers, or the SGR train are available. From Nairobi, safari routes extend to Amboseli, Tsavo, or the Masai Mara depending on the package chosen. Kenya safari packages often include private transfers or scheduled flights to reduce travel time, especially for luxury options. Road safaris are common for budget and mid-range travelers, offering flexibility and the chance to see more of the countryside.
For those combining safari with Diani Beach, the SGR train to Mombasa is a sustainable and cost-effective option, followed by a short road transfer or flight to Ukunda airstrip near Diani. Kenya safari packages that emphasize eco-travel often recommend this train route to reduce carbon footprint. Alternatively, domestic flights from Nairobi to coastal airports provide faster access for travelers who want more time at the beach. What to pack for Kenya safari packages
When preparing for Kenya safari packages, packing smart ensures comfort and practicality both in the parks and at Diani Beach. Lightweight, neutral-colored clothing is best for game drives, as it blends with the environment and keeps you cool. Include a wide-brimmed hat, sunglasses, and sunscreen for sun protection, plus a light jacket for cooler mornings and evenings. Sturdy walking shoes are essential, while sandals or flip-flops work well at the coast. A reusable water bottle, insect repellent, and personal medications should be prioritized. For photography, carry a good camera, extra memory cards, and binoculars. Swimwear, beach cover-ups, and casual wear are perfect for Diani. Food and drink experiences are a highlight, blending safari flavors with coastal cuisine. On safari, expect hearty meals featuring grilled meats, fresh vegetables, and Kenyan staples like ugali, often served outdoors for a unique atmosphere. At Diani, seafood dominates menus, with prawns, crab, and fish prepared in Swahili style, complemented by tropical fruits and international dishes for variety. Beach bars and resort restaurants serve cocktails, fresh coconut water, and fine wines, creating a relaxed coastal vibe.
